Manchester City have released a four-part mini-series documenting the final 30 days of the club's historic domestic treble-winning campaign in 2018/19.
City famously had their 100 points-attaining season in 2017/18 charted in the groundbreaking Amazon 'All or Nothing' show and have now moved to produce this new documentary, titled 'Fight till the end', in-house through their City TV channel.
Pep Guardiola allowed cameras to film training sessions at the club's Etihad Campus as well as the changing rooms, giving fans behind the scenes access to the tense finale which saw the Blues win all six of their remaining games in all competitions to pip Liverpool to the title on the final day - before rounding off the season with a 6-0 humbling of Watford in the FA Cup final.

The series also features never-seen-before footage of Vincent Kompany's emotional Wembley dressing room goodbye to the City players after 11 trophy-laden years at the club came to an end.
